在Angular单元测试代码的it方法里连续调用两次detectChange方法,会触发两次ngAfterViewInit吗
生活随笔
收集整理的這篇文章主要介紹了
在Angular单元测试代码的it方法里连续调用两次detectChange方法,会触发两次ngAfterViewInit吗
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
做一個測試:
測試結果:第67行執行完畢之后,ngOnChange和ngAfterViewInit均未觸發。
即使手動修改Component的屬性也沒用了:
單元測試里修改的屬性已經生效了:
還是解析到了我的Directive啊:
整個current都為空,執行不進去了:
current字段是在2130行被清空的:
更多Jerry的原創文章,盡在:“汪子熙”:
總結
以上是生活随笔為你收集整理的在Angular单元测试代码的it方法里连续调用两次detectChange方法,会触发两次ngAfterViewInit吗的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 华为畅享9指纹在哪里(华为技术有限公司)
- 下一篇: Angular单元测试遇到的错误消息:U